Allied Blenders and Distillers reported FY26 standalone revenue of Rs 7,50,983 lakhs, down 7% from Rs 8,07,296 lakhs in FY25. Despite the revenue decline, profit after tax grew 34% to Rs 26,833 lakhs from Rs 20,013 lakhs. EBITDA improved significantly from Rs 45,300 lakhs to Rs 60,417 lakhs, indicating better cost control and operational efficiency. Basic EPS increased to Rs 9.59 from Rs 7.38. The Board recommended a 50% higher dividend of Rs 5.40 per share. The company also approved fund-raising of up to Rs 1,000 crores through equity or convertible securities. Statutory auditors issued an unmodified opinion. Two emphasis of matter items exist: a CSD customer dispute of Rs 3,399 lakhs under arbitration, and income tax litigation resulting in Rs 2,608 lakhs tax expense plus Rs 1,938 lakhs interest.
Revenue declined but profitability improved substantially with PAT growth of 34% and EBITDA margin expansion. Higher debt levels and ongoing tax litigation are watch items. Fund-raising plan may dilute existing shareholders.
